Fact Checks (3)
"I built the greatest Golf properties in the World in Scotland"
Half True

Trump owns Trump Turnberry (historic, prestigious course in Ayrshire) and Trump International Golf Links (Aberdeenshire). Both are significant properties. 'Greatest in the World' is subjective superlative without objective support; other courses (Augusta National, St Andrews, Pebble Beach) would contest the claim.

"She fought me all the way, making my job much more difficult"
Mostly True

Sturgeon and the Scottish Government did oppose aspects of Trump's developments. The wind farm dispute near Aberdeenshire resulted in Trump losing in Scotland's Supreme Court (2015). Sturgeon personally opposed Trump's approach and they had documented public conflicts. 'All the way' somewhat overstates a relationship that had some periods of routine governmental interaction.

"The wonderful people of Scotland are much better off without Sturgeon in office"
Unverifiable

This is political opinion presented as objective fact. Sturgeon maintained relatively high approval ratings during much of her tenure as First Minister and oversaw significant SNP electoral successes. The claim has no empirical basis as stated.
